Sobre este artículo

Macmillan, 1946. Hardback. First edition, 1946. Green cloth with gilt lettering to spine. Good condition; boards clean and bright, slight bumps to spine and corners, tanning to pages and fore edges, pages clean and tightly bound in Good minus unclipped dust jacket; edgeworn with some marks, chips and small tears, sunned to spine and around edges. Published: Macmillan, 1946
